- 博客(6)
- 收藏
- 关注
原创 Java多线程实现龟兔赛跑问题
话不多说,直接上代码。题目:要求跑步的距离相同,兔子的速度是乌龟的5倍,乌龟不会偷懒, 兔子偷懒的概率是80%下面是用随机数来实现概率的(引用Random类),从四个数中选定一个,选到指定的一个就让兔子跑,这样就可以实现兔子偷懒的概率是百分之80了。因为每次循环都花1秒钟,所以用sleep做。import java.util.Random;public class TortoiseHare { public static void main(String[] args.
2022-05-28 18:55:59
333
原创 Ubuntu如何切换到root用户
首先按住ctrl+alt+t打开终端:如果你第一次切换root用户sudo passwd root先输入的是当前用户的密码,后面是设置root用户的密码再输入:su root当看到那个$变成#就说明切换到了root用户
2022-05-25 22:08:13
864
原创 记录修复Ubuntu20.04开机后桌面卡住只有鼠标能动
ji20.04ubuntu,在安装完搜狗拼音和fcitx之后出现重启输入密码后黑屏只有鼠标可移动问题问题。我琢磨了很久终于成功首先ctrl+alt+F6进入命令行的界面(如若F6不行就走F2)login输入用户名就是@前一个,比如我的就是martin01,password就是输入你的密码我当时就猜测会不是是搜狗输入法和桌面启动程序冲突。然后尝试重置gnome桌面配置:dconf reset -f /org/gnome/之后就可以输入密码进入桌面,进入桌面打开终端,删...
2022-05-06 16:58:08
4664
7
原创 编写方法 peak(int[][] matix),显示matix中的所有局部最大值。
本人刚上手java小白,有错望各位大神及时批评指正。package Martin;import java.util.Scanner;public class Martin03 { public static void main(String[] args) { Scanner sc = new Scanner(System.in);// 定义数组的长、宽 System.out.println("请输入数组的行和列:"); ..
2022-03-17 20:21:51
572
原创 进程的生命周期
进程的动态特征表明:它由创建而生,由调度而执行,由撤销而消亡。说明进程具有一个从生到死的生命周期。就绪状态:指进程得到了除CPU以外所有必要资源就等CPU开始发动了。执行状态:得到调度被分配到CPU,就会从就绪状态转换为执行状态。单CPU只能执行单进程,多CPU可以进行多进程。阻塞状态:指执行状态受到i/o的影响变为阻塞状态,等i/o完成后又变为就绪状态。创建状态:指的是为程序分配合适的pcb格式,然后放入内存,如果由于内存不足,暂未放入主存,创建工作并未完成,进程不能被调用,则被成为创建状
2022-02-24 23:08:52
3647
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人